漯河网站推广多少钱,网站网站建设策划书,制作网页时一般不选用的图像文件格式是,网站上线后做什么需求#xff1a;随机生成一个指定长度的字符串#xff08;数字和小写字母#xff09;
涉及到的python知识点
#xff08;1#xff09;python模块包#xff1a;random
random.choice(sequence)#xff1a;从指定的序列中获取一个随机元素
random.choice(sequence)从序…需求随机生成一个指定长度的字符串数字和小写字母
涉及到的python知识点
1python模块包random
random.choice(sequence)从指定的序列中获取一个随机元素
random.choice(sequence)从序列中获取一个随机元素参数sequence表示一个有序类型。sequence在Python中不是一种特定的类型而是泛指序列数据结构。列表元组字符串都属于sequence
random.sample(sequence,k):用于从指定序列中随机获取指定长度的片段
k为指定长度返回结果为长度为k的列表
2join()函数
在Python中可以使用join()函数将一个列表中的元素拼接成一个字符串。
实现代码
import randomdef generate_random_string(length):# 定义字符集characters abcdefghijklmnopqrstuvwxyz1234567890random_string .join(random.choice(characters) for _ in range(length))return random_string# 随机生成32位的字符串
randon_string generate_random_string(32)
print(randon_string)